The Heart of the Safari: Tarangire and Lake Manyara
Our first destination was Tarangire National Park, a place renowned for its large elephant herds and iconic baobab trees. As we traversed the park, the landscape unfolded like a living tapestry, each scene more breathtaking than the last. From the open roof of our safari jeep, I marveled at the sight of elephants ambling gracefully among the acacias, their presence a testament to the park’s thriving ecosystem.
Goodluck’s ability to spot wildlife was nothing short of miraculous. He pointed out a pride of lions lounging in the shade, their golden coats blending seamlessly with the sun-drenched grass. As we continued our journey, he shared fascinating insights into the behavior and ecology of the animals we encountered, enriching my understanding and appreciation of these magnificent creatures.
Lake Manyara National Park was our next stop, a jewel of biodiversity nestled between the Great Rift Valley and the alkaline lake that gives the park its name. Here, the air was alive with the calls of over 500 bird species, including the vibrant pink flamingos that flocked to the lake’s shores. The park’s diverse landscapes, from dense woodlands to open savannahs, provided a stunning backdrop for the wildlife that called it home.
Serengeti and Ngorongoro: The Pinnacle of the Journey
The Serengeti, a name synonymous with the great migration, was the highlight of our safari. As we entered the park, the vast plains stretched endlessly before us, a sea of golden grass punctuated by the occasional acacia tree. It was here that I witnessed the awe-inspiring spectacle of thousands of wildebeest and zebras on their annual pilgrimage, a testament to the resilience and adaptability of nature.
Our days in the Serengeti were filled with unforgettable encounters. We watched in hushed silence as a cheetah stalked its prey, its movements a masterclass in grace and precision. We marveled at the sight of a leopard lounging in the branches of a tree, its spotted coat dappled by the sunlight filtering through the leaves.
The final leg of our journey took us to the Ngorongoro Crater, a natural wonder that defies description. As we descended into the crater, the landscape transformed into a verdant paradise, teeming with life. Here, I had the rare opportunity to photograph the endangered black rhino, a moment that underscored the importance of conservation efforts in preserving these incredible species for future generations.
